If you want to go to the most expensive ski area in France (Mottaret) during the peak season as we have to, but are not lucky enough to have the cash to pay for expensive accommodation, then the Le Hameu ticks all the right boxes for ski in - ski out, locality of slopes, shops, ski hire, free transport to Meribel and a bar which has a happy hour with a roaring fire. We have stayed there 3 times so far and we have booked for Feb half term this year. The apartments have always been clean and warm, with lots of hot water and very quiet.
Last year we stayed in the Pierre Vacances by the ski meeting area in Mottaret and to be honest with you the accommodation was smaller and we had a long trek up lifts along balconies and then up more stairs to get back to our apartments, and of course, we had to do all this with our luggage on arrival and departure also.
Admittedly the Hameau does need serious refurbishment and if we booked with a tour operator and paid masses for it, we would be annoyed, but we book independently and pay about half of what the tour operators charge.
